Synopsis

Red Hat Enterprise MRG Messaging 3.2.1 Bug Fix Release

Type/Severity

Bug Fix Advisory

Red Hat Lightspeed patch analysis

Identify and remediate systems affected by this advisory.

View affected systems

Topic

Updated Red Hat Enterprise MRG Messaging 3.2 packages are now available Red Hat Enterprise Linux 6.

Description

Red Hat Enterprise MRG is a next-generation IT infrastructure incorporating
Messaging, Realtime, and Grid functionality. It offers increased performance,
reliability, interoperability, and faster computing for enterprise customers.

MRG Messaging is a high-speed reliable messaging distribution for Linux based on
AMQP (Advanced Message Queuing Protocol), an open protocol standard for
enterprise messaging that is designed to make mission critical messaging widely
available as a standard service, and to make enterprise messaging interoperable
across platforms, programming languages, and vendors.

MRG Messaging includes AMQP messaging broker; AMQP client libraries for C++,
Java JMS, and Python; as well as persistence libraries and management tools.

These updated packages for Red Hat Enterprise Linux 6 include a bug
fix for the Messaging component of MRG.

It was found that any message property declared as an unsigned 16 bit integer would get converted to an unsigned 8 bit value in the broker. If the value was greater than 255, an error would occur in the conversion.

The code has been updated to ensure the conversion performs as expected and unsigned 16 bit integer values in the message header are now correctly maintained in the broker.(BZ#11301359)

Users of Red Hat Enterprise MRG Messaging 3.2 on Red Hat Enterprise Linux 6 are advised to upgrade to these updated
packages.
